I love podcasts - been listening to them for 12+ years. What kind of topics do you like? I've added some links where possible to some suggestions.

For history - The Rest is History is on a different level for me. Very engaging presenters - my knowledge has increased. Their recent episodes on the holocaust were moving and insightful.

We Have Ways of Making you Talk - predominantly focusses on the second world war. Al Murray is one of the hosts.

Battlefield Ukraine - has some serious guests keeping us up to date on what is actually happening. The episodes on the deployment of A.I. and Cyber attacks were unbelievable.

Sports chat and comedy - The Socially Distant Sports Bar is absolutely superb. I'm a Patreon and cannot get enough of these guys. Made up of comedians and journalists. Ellis James is one of hosts. The are currently running some Pint Sized tasters that you may enjoy - if you like sports and a good laugh.

Honourable mentions - The Frank Skinner show from Absolute radio, The Joe Marler Show, That Peter Crouch Show & The Johnny Vaughan show.

Happy exploring :)

The Two Shot Podcast hosted by Craig Parkinson* is excellent. Mainly interviews with actors. There’s two episodes with Joseph Gilgun (Woody from This is England/Brassic). He really opens about his mental health issues which goes really dark but also is really funny too. I’ve listened to quite a few and they have all been very interesting and entertaining.
